Damash - Resubelpara, North Garo Hills
Damash is a village situated in the Resubelpara subdivision of North Garo Hills district, Meghalaya. It is located approximately 17 km from Resubelpara and around 70 km from Williamnagar.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Damash is 274695. The village falls under the 794005 pincode.
Damash village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system. For political representation, the village falls under the Mendipathar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Tura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Damash
As per Census 2011, Damash village has a total population of 1,606 people, consisting of 799 males and 807 females. The village has 268 households and a sex ratio of 1,010 females per 1,000 males. There are 255 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,259 literate and 347 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1,556 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Damash are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,606 | 799 | 807 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 255 | 122 | 133 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1,556 | 772 | 784 |
| Literate Population | 1,259 | 633 | 626 |
| Illiterate Population | 347 | 166 | 181 |

Transport and Connectivity of Damash
Damash is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Damash.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Williamnagar to Damash is about 70 km, with the usual travel time around ~2 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.

Health Facilities in Damash
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Damash village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within <1 km |
